School Notes
- Pui Tak Christian School is a unique Christian preschool and elementary school in the heart of Chicago's Chinatown. Begun as a preschool in 1953 and expanded to include Kindergarten through Eigth grade in 2001, Pui Tak Christian School is a member of the Association of Christian Schools International.
- Character Development: "Pui Tak" is a Chinese phrase meaning 'to build character or cultivate virtue.' It is our mission to create an educational environment that encourages students to develop exceptional character traits and admirable social skills. In addition our curriculum is designed to provide quality academic skills and creativity to prepare our students to be lifelong learners.
- Small Class Size: One advantage to Pui Tak Christian School is our commitment to a small class size. We maintain a standard of having no more than 20 students per room, enabling our teachers to give direct one-on-one attention to their students, and allows students to learn more freely at their own pace. Small classes also help the teacher have a better understanding of and interaction with just who your children are, and what the children's specific strengths and limitations are.
- Our Teachers: Pui Tak teachers are State certified and professionally trained. We choose experienced educators with training specific to the subject they will be teaching. Students at Pui Tak have many opportunities to form close relationships with their teachers, allowing the teachers to better gauge the students' level of engagement with class materials. In addition, Pui Tak emphasizes the cooperative relationship between parents and teachers, and strives to keep parents abreast of developments in their children's academic progress.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much does Pui Tak Christian School cost?
Pui Tak Christian School's tuition is approximately $6,200 for private students and $950 for summer students.
What is the acceptance rate of Pui Tak Christian School?
The acceptance rate of Pui Tak Christian School is 80%, which is lower than the national average of 85%. Pui Tak Christian School's acceptance rate is ranked among the top private schools in Illinois with low acceptance rates.
Does Pui Tak Christian School offer a summer program?
Yes, Pui Tak Christian School offers a summer program. Visit their summer school page for more information.
What is Pui Tak Christian School's ranking?
Pui Tak Christian School ranks among the top 20% of private schools in Illinois for: Lowest average acceptance rates, Highest percentage of students of color and Highest percentage of faculty with advanced degrees.
When is the application deadline for Pui Tak Christian School?
The application deadline for Pui Tak Christian School is rolling (applications are reviewed as they are received year-round).
In what neighborhood is Pui Tak Christian School located?
Pui Tak Christian School is located in the Armour Square neighborhood of Chicago, IL. There are 2 other private schools located in Armour Square.
